FAMILY doctors in Stoke-on-Trent will be offered cash incentives to open their surgeries on Thursday afternoons.
More than 40 of the city's 55 practices still close on Thursday afternoons in a throwback to the days of half-day closing in the city on Thursdays.See the full content of this document
